Places to visit

1. Copenhagen

The most chosen city in Denmark vacation packages, Copenhagen is a treasure trove of food, culture, architecture, and scenic sights. It was formerly a Viking fishing village and now has a cityscape, which makes it look like a Nordic fairy tale. The city is lovely to bicycle around and has many Michelin starred restaurants to appease its tourists’ tastebuds.

2. Aarhus

On Jutland Peninsula’s east coast is the city of Aarhus. There are many interesting points of interest in Aarhus like the Den Gamle By, the Viking Museum, the Aarhus Cathedral, and the Aarhus Docklands. There is also the Tivoli Friheden, which is known for friends and family entertainment with its fun activities.

3. Zeland

An island in Denmark, there are many small towns and villages that occupy the different directional coasts of Zeland. This island also has popular holiday areas with amazing sandy beaches and fjords. There’s also Møn’s Klint and Stevns Klint, which are fossil-rich cliffs with amazing views of the Baltic Sea.

4. Helsingør

A port city in eastern Denmark, the Helsingør has many architectural wonders dating back to the 15th century. There is also a Maritime Museum of Denmark, which has wondrous illustrations of 600 years of Danish history. The Helsingør Cathedral, the Helsingør City Museum, and the Danish Museum of Science and Technology are some of the most amazing places to see here.

5. Odense

The third-largest city in Denmark and the main city of Funen island, Odense is full of castles, cathedrals, museums, and a zoo. The best points of interest in Odense is the Odense Zoo, the Funen Village, the H.C Andersens House, and the Danmarks Jernbanemuseum. Include this destination in your Denmark tour package.

Best time to visit

Spring (March to April)

A great break from the chilling winter months, the spring season brings with itself, beautiful blue skies and comfortable weather. That makes it the perfect choice for a holiday. The crowd is generally light during this time, though, making it a great time to travel across the city.

Summer (May to August)

Undoubtedly the best time to visit Denmark, this season has a mild sun and usually clear skies. Denmark is glorious during this time with lots of festivals and flowers in full blossom. The average temperature is about 22 degrees Celcius and the country is beautiful.

Autumn (September to October)

Falling golden leaves and solemnity in the air, Autumn is another favorite time for tourists to visit Denmark. The coastal waters are cool at this time and the beaches may not see a lot of sunlight but the countryside is gorgeous in this season.

Winters (November to February)

Biting cold in Denmark, these months have temperatures going down to 15 degrees Celcius. This is the time of the least tourism activity and Denmark travel packages are not sold a lot during this time.

FAQs for Denmark

Is Denmark very expensive?

Contrary to the belief, Denmark is not one of the most expensive countries in Europe.

What is Denmark’s official currency and can we use Euros here?

The official Denmark currency is Danish Kroner and yes, euros are accepted throughout the country. 

What are the most famous foods in Denmark?

Open face sandwiches, Herring, and Rye bread are some of the most famous food dishes in Denmark. 

What is the best time to book the Denmark holiday packages?

Early summers are the best time to book Denmark holidays.

What are the warmest months in Denmark?

July is the warmest month with the temperature averaging to 16 degrees Celcius.

Things to do

Keep these things in mind while buying a Denmark package:

1. Say hello to animals at the Copenhagen zoo

One of the oldest zoos in Europe, the Copenhagen Zoo first opened in 1859. It has restored its charm since then and now spans to a sprawling 27 acres with 264 different species of 3,000 or more animals. There are different sections of the zoo where you will find snakes, deer, and even reptiles along with a butterfly garden. People can also get up close and personal with dwarf goats of the region.

2. Trek to Råbjerg Mile

The Denmark holiday packages may not include this experience but it is a must-do when in Denmark. It is nestled in the North Jutland region and is the largest moving sand dune in Northern Europe. It moves at 18 meters per year and has over 250,000 people visiting this attraction throughout the year.

3. Appreciate the Egeskov Castle in Funen

One of the most beautiful European buildings made in Renaissance style, Egeskov has a mighty Knights’ Hall and other elegant structures here. The area around the castle has famous beautiful interiors a large forest around it. You will also find a Segway course here.

4. Visit the Hans Christian Andersen Museum in Odense

Remember the great children’s writer? Hans Christian Andersen was born in Odense and also has a museum to his name. It was made in 1908 and narrates a lovely story of the life of the writer. One can attend multiple exhibitions that occur here with his unique paintings and drawing.

5. Build something at the Legoland in Billund

Be it, kids or adults, a visit to Legoland is full of fun, frolic, and lots of innovation. It is made in 25 acres of land and has an astonishing number of blocks- 40 million. Yes, you read that right! There are also lego recreations of the most famous monuments of Denmark and the world here. Multiple rides and themed areas are also present here like Duplo land, Pirateland, etc.

Travel tips

  • Even if you are traveling to Denmark in summers, make sure you carry a light jacket. The weather is unpredictable sometimes.
  • To go around the cities in Denmark, it’s best to take public transport or even walk around.
  • Don’t leave Denmark without Danish pastries. It’s one of the main reasons that the Denmark trip packages are such a hit among travelers.
